Multimodal Imaging Unmasks Occult Acute Anterior Myocardial Infarction After Blunt Chest Trauma in a Young Male
Fady Khoury1, Jonathan Schilling2, Dhananjay Chatterjee2
1Department of Internal Medicine, Los Robles Regional Medical Center, Thousand Oaks, California, USA.
Background:
Blunt chest trauma is rarely associated with acute plaque rupture and myocardial infarction in young patients without cardiovascular risk factors.
Case Summary:
A 36-year-old man developed severe substernal chest pain immediately after blunt anterior chest trauma while surfing. High-sensitivity troponin I rose rapidly (197-5,700 ng/L over 6 hours). Computed tomography angiography performed to exclude pulmonary embolism showed left ventricular hypoperfusion and a proximal left anterior descending artery filling defect. Echocardiography confirmed an ejection fraction of 40% to 45% with regional wall motion abnormalities. Emergent catheterization revealed 100% thrombotic occlusion of the proximal-to-mid left anterior descending artery due to plaque rupture. Aspiration thrombectomy and drug-eluting stent placement restored TIMI flow grade 3.
Discussion:
This case illustrates how multimodal imaging rapidly unmasks occult acute anterior myocardial infarction when initial clinical and electrocardiographic findings are equivocal in the trauma setting.
Take-Home Messages:
A low threshold for advanced imaging and serial high-sensitivity troponin monitoring should be maintained in trauma-related chest pain regardless of age or risk factors. Multimodal imaging enables timely reperfusion and excellent outcomes in occult acute myocardial infarction.
